Photograph, dated November 9, 1924, of a large crowd of people at the Colliton Discovery Well in Cherokee County, Texas. The details in the image are incredibly sharp. The main focus is on eight men who have been identified by name and occupation. Their names are J. G. C. Corcoran, J. A. Colliton, Bill Williams, Arthur Brineard (or Brincard?), Ross Compton, Buron Sessions, Barney Compton, and Lee Sessions.
